About
Not dying today is a 2D side-scrolling action game. In 2030, the world has been taken over by zombies. With fire and blade, bullets and guns, you, captain Aiden, will do anything to protect the last human kind, anything, even turn into a zombie, using zombie power to kill zombies.

Not Dying Today — Session FAQ
- How long does a session of Not Dying Today take?
- The minimum meaningful session for Not Dying Today is approximately 15 minutes. This is the shortest play window where you can make real progress or have a satisfying experience, based on community data.
- Can you pause Not Dying Today?
- Not Dying Today uses save points or manual saves. You'll need to reach a checkpoint before exiting to avoid losing progress — factor this into your session planning.
- Does Not Dying Today pressure you to keep playing?
- Not Dying Today has no FOMO mechanics — no timed events, live content, or narrative cliffhangers. You can stop whenever you want without feeling like you're missing out.
